Real estate & living comparison
| Zhubei | Aguadilla | |
|---|---|---|
| International Primary School, Annual Tuition per Child | 16762.98 USD | 12862.92 USD |
| Private Full-Day Preschool or Kindergarten, Monthly Fee per Child | 655.24 USD | 875.2 USD |
| Jeans (Levi's 501 or Similar) | 57.63 USD | 48.5 USD |
| Men's Leather Business Shoes | 99.47 USD | 108 USD |
| Apples (1 kg) | 4.11 USD | 5.06 USD |
| Bananas (1 kg) | 2.8 USD | 2.6 USD |
| 3 Bedroom Apartment in City Centre | 1105.22 USD | 2000 USD |
| Bottled Water (0.33 Liter) | 0.62 USD | 1 USD |
| Cappuccino (Regular Size) | 2.86 USD | 1.5 USD |
| Annual Mortgage Interest Rate (20-Year Fixed, in %) | 2.4 USD | 7.8 USD |
| Average Monthly Net Salary (After Tax) | 2441.66 USD | 1350 USD |
| Cinema Ticket (International Release) | 10.1 USD | 10.5 USD |
| Monthly Fitness Club Membership | 31.58 USD | 35 USD |
| Gasoline (1 Liter) | 0.98 USD | 0.88 USD |
| Taxi 1 Hour Waiting (Standard Tariff) | 9.47 USD | 42 USD |
| Basic Utilities for 85 m2 Apartment (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water, Garbage) | 86.58 USD | 120 USD |
| Broadband Internet (Unlimited Data, 60 Mbps or Higher) | 22.72 USD | 70.37 USD |
| Population | 212,695 | 235,546 |
